Alfonso Giordano is a scholar working on Neurology, Psychiatry and Mental health and Cognitive Neuroscience. According to data from OpenAlex, Alfonso Giordano has authored 47 papers receiving a total of 1.5k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 25 papers in Neurology, 18 papers in Psychiatry and Mental health and 16 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ience. Recurrent topics in Alfonso Giordano’s work include Parkinson's Disease Mechanisms and Treatments (20 papers), Functional Brain Connectivity Studies (14 papers) and Neurological disorders and treatments (13 papers). Alfonso Giordano is often cited by papers focused on Parkinson's Disease Mechanisms and Treatments (20 papers), Functional Brain Connectivity Studies (14 papers) and Neurological disorders and treatments (13 papers). Alfonso Giordano collaborates with scholars based in Italy, The Netherlands and United Kingdom. Alfonso Giordano's co-authors include Gioacchino Tedeschi, Alessandro Tessitore, Fabrizio Esposito, Antonio Russo, Rosa De Micco, Daniele Corbo, Renata Conforti, Francesca Conte, Giuseppina Caiazzo and Manuela De Stefano and has published in prestigious journals such as Brain, Neurology and Journal of Neurology Neurosurgery & Psychiatry.
